LAKE COUNTY, Fla. — The Florida Department of Law Enforcement arrested a Lake County man who is accused of downloading child pornography on his computer.
Agents served a search warrant at William Keehn's home in Sorrento Tuesday morning, authorities said.
Detectives said they have been investigating Keehn since late 2014, when they discovered child pornography was being shared from his home computer.
FDLE said in addition to the computer and child pornography, they found hidden cameras at Keehn's house.
"Numerous computers, computer equipment, DVDs, cameras, web cameras, things of that nature were seized as evidence, along with child pornography," FDLE Special Agent Jack Massey said.
Because of all of the cameras seized, investigators said they fear Keehn could have been making his own child pornography.
"Any parents who believe their children were over at this gentleman's house, this defendant's house, please call the police department and let us know," Massey said.

Authorities said Keehn is married and has children. He's being held at the Lake County Jail without bond.
